Transaction 3901c5b7d2e642e419933fa7628d3da53a3ac759bdbdf7fca6890874e4a5f713

1 Input
2 Outputs
  • 3901c5b7d2e642e419933fa7628d3da53a3ac759bdbdf7fca6890874e4a5f713:0
  • value  431608
    address  1FekU4skCxGDnt8FtfiKqRyBikYkJ2M69P
  • 3901c5b7d2e642e419933fa7628d3da53a3ac759bdbdf7fca6890874e4a5f713:1
  • value  19930000
    address  3Dsm1UwabdHue3rPQdiUC3rwKuNgvSXsQH